This week on The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ills, Denise Richards flipped out, demanding that Bravo stop filming after Brandi’s claims went public.
But in the previews for next week’s episode, Denise drops a bombshell: who else has banged Brandi?
As explosive as Wednesday night’s episode was, the previews reveal that there is more to come.
"I don’t know Brandi Glanville very well," Teddi freely admits as the ladies dine in Rome.
She then addresses Denise, acknowledging:
"I don’t know you very well, either."
"I will tell you," Denise claims, "Brandi said that she’s had sex with some of the people from this group."
By this group … does Denise mean Real Housewives in general, or something more specific.
Either way, that is a very salacious claim to make — especially because she is being so vague.
It is Kyle who asks for clarification, asking: "Someone at this table right now?"
"Yes," Denise alleges.
Well that certainly narrows things down a bit!
At this point, we’re not sure whether we’re seeing the actual reaction that the Housewives have, or if it’s the nature of reality TV previews at work.
(The actual episode that airs next week may be more clear … or maybe not)
But it looks like all eyes immediately turn to face one Housewife in particular under suspicion that she, too, has boned Brandi Glanville.
The woman whom they are turning to face? Lisa Rinna.
Now, Lisa herself appears to feel backed into a bit of a corner as this happens.
We do not get to hear any real kind of response from her before the preview for next week’s episode fades to black.
